Subject: Pricing experiment — ownership handoff

Hey — quick heads-up before your review of the Tollgate ticket-pricing experiment. I'm rolling off the Fernhollow growth pod at the end of the sprint, so the experiment config, the holdout group logic, and the audit log for price overrides are all changing hands. Nothing in the data flow itself changes; same anonymized cohort pipeline you reviewed last quarter. Flag anything odd in the override log directly to the new owner. Going forward, the experiment is owned by the person named below.

account owner for fajep-yagef: Kasix Eliiel

Ticket: GPUMEM-188 — vramlens profiler double-counts shared allocations

vramlens reports shared texture pools twice when two streams map the same buffer on the Keldora render farm nodes. Totals exceed physical VRAM, which breaks the alerting thresholds. Fix: dedupe by allocation handle before aggregation. Tests exist in the profiler suite; extend rather than replace them. Note for future maintainers: this only reproduces with driver-managed pooling enabled. Repro build's trace token is below.

session token of yahof-bajeg = htk9_0d43d44ed

Ticket: Turnstile counter drift at Harrowfield Stadium

Support team: the GateTally counters at Harrowfield have drifted from the deployed baseline — debounce intervals and sync cadence were changed locally after the season opener, causing mismatched attendance totals between gates. Please restore units to the standard settings. The correct configuration values are listed below.

deployment values, hahip-kajep:
HOLAX_PIN=4003
HOLAX_METRICS_HOST=metrics.holax.zemvarworks.internal
HOLAX_LOG_LEVEL=warn
HOLAX_TENANT=fraael

## Runbook: Slow template rendering (Quillforge)

If p95 render latency on Quillforge exceeds two seconds, check the partial-cache hit rate first. Cold caches after a deploy usually recover within ten minutes; if they don't, the precompile worker likely crashed. Restart it and confirm the template registry is warm before touching autoscaling. Do not bump worker counts blindly — rendering is memory-bound and extra workers have caused OOM cascades on the Ketterly cluster. Verify the live settings against the known-good configuration below:

service settings:
[casax]
port = 6379
team = rusir
host = casax.zemvarhq.corp
region = outer-4
access_code = ac_9808ce
timeout_ms = 1500